
London-based artist Rob Clarke has an upcoming show of dog portraits called The A-Z of Dogs at Rebecca Hossack in London.
What: The A-Z of Dogs – dog portraits by Rob Clarke
When: April 1, 2011 – April 21, 2011
Where: Rebecca Hossack Art Gallery, 28 Charlotte Street, Fitzrovia, London W1T 2NA

Dogtography is an exhibition that features photos taken by dogs and opens this Thursday, March 10th at Hendershot Gallery. Benefits Mighty Mutts no-kill animal shelter.

Award-winning photographer Martin Usborne will present a new solo exhibition, MUTE, at East London gallery theprintspace on Thursday October 21, 2010. The exhibition consists of photographic prints of dogs looking silently out of car windows in the dead of night. While you might think that this is a statement on leaving dogs in hot cars — it’s not. Rather, Martin is exploring the sense of loneliness and isolation that many humans (and animals) experience in modern times. These images are poignant and haunting.
